This website works better with JavaScript.
Home
Explore
Help
Register
Sign In
auto-locksmith-luton8231
/
7047wikimapia.org
Watch
1
Star
0
Code
Issues
0
Projects
0
Wiki
Watchers
Leo Wilshire
https://wikimapia.org/external_link?url=https://kloster-boye.mdwrite.net/14-businesses-doing-a-superb-job-at-car-locksmiths-in-luton
Powered by
TurnKey Linux
.